Automobili Lamborghini Sets Another Record in 2016

Stefano Domenicali, Chairman  and  Chief  Executive  Officer  of  Automobili Lamborghini  comments: “Lamborghini  realized  another  record  year  and  we are once more outperforming our planned figures. In the face of the biggest expansion  in  our  company’s  long  history,  in  the  build-up  of  our  product portfolio,  our  development  and  production  capacities,  we  are  introducing fascinating new products, creating new jobs and increasing our profitability. All of this could not have been done without our excellent team that deserves all the credit.”

All major sales regions EMEA (Europe, Middle East, Africa), America and Asia Pacific set new records and contributed to the sales growth. The USA remain the largest single market with 1,250 units sold.  Thanks to the Huracán model the year 2016 has been the most successful yet in Lamborghini’s history for V10 sales. A total of 2,353 units (up from 2,242 in 2015)  of  the  Huracán  Coupé  and  Spyder  were  delivered  to  customers.  The twelve-cylinder model Aventador increased from 1,003 units in 2015 to 1,104 units in 2016.

In  2016,  five  new  models  were  launched.  The  Centenario  Coupé  and  the Centenario  Roadster  were  presented  as  a  limited  series  in  memory  of  the anniversary of company founder Ferruccio Lamborghini. Other special series included  the  Huracán  Avio  and  the  Aventador  Miura  Homage,  which  was conceived in celebration of the fiftieth anniversary of the Miura, the ancestor of  all  Lamborghini  V12  super  sports  cars.  The  new  Lamborghini  Huracán  Rear Wheel Drive Spyder was launched to the market at the Los Angeles Auto Show in November. At the end of 2016 the new Aventador S was presented. 

Positive and convincing outlook while preparing for a new era After  a  long  upturn  and  extensive  strategic  preparation  for  further  growth Lamborghini maintains a confident outlook for the current year. Starting from 2018,  the  Lamborghini  SUV  Urus  will  be  the  third  model  in  Lamborghini’s product  range.  Delivering  additional  growth  and  significant  opportunities across  the  marque,  it  will  also  determine  a  substantial  increase  in  the production  capacity  of  the  Sant’  Agata  Bolognese  factory.  The  production facilities will increase from 80,000 to 150,000 m2 and the production capacity will double to 7,000 units per year.
